How Much Can I Scrap My Car for in Inverness?
Looking for the best scrap car prices Inverness offers? The A9 corridor and Inverness’s Highland gateway position make it the northernmost competitive ATF hub in Britain. Your scrap value depends on three factors: catalytic converter condition (intact cats with platinum group metals add £80–£450), salvageable parts (engine, gearbox, body panels), and the current scrap metal market rate.
Small hatchbacks return £95–£225 scrap or £175–£450 salvage. Mid-size cars £145–£325 scrap or £250–£665 salvage. SUVs £225–£520 scrap. Big 4x4s up to £1,800 salvage. Vans from £255. All guaranteed prices with no hidden fees.

How Do I Scrap My Car in Inverness?
Enter your reg and IV postcode for an instant guaranteed quote. Book same-day scrap car collection – available across all Inverness postcodes. Our driver arrives with a flatbed, checks your ID, loads the vehicle (non-runners, write-offs, MOT failures all accepted), and pays you by BACS on the spot. We handle all DVLA paperwork: V5C notification, deregistration, and the licensed ATF issues your Certificate of Destruction confirming legal recycling under the ELV Regulations. Your road tax refund arrives automatically within 4–6 weeks. No scrap yard visit needed.

What Are the Most Commonly Scrapped Cars in Inverness?
Every scrap yard Inverness operates sees a distinctive local mix. The most commonly scrapped makes are:
Corsas and Astras serve as Inverness’s affordable city cars. Timing chain failure and Highland winter salt corrosion are the triggers at local scrap yards. A9 commuting produces high-mileage vehicles reaching end of life earlier than central belt equivalents.
Hilux and Yaris. The Hilux is the Highland farmer’s workhorse reaching Inverness’s scrap yards from across the north. Even Toyota’s reliability can’t beat Highland salt. Yaris models popular with the city’s older demographic are scrapped on corrosion at local scrap yards.
